Thanks again kaz. I suppose it comes from doing slimming world I got used to quorn doing it. With the mince a trick I learnt was to boil the mince with some bovril (not sure on the points) I suppose you could use stock cubes or something.
It gives it a much more meaty flavor, if you drain off most of the juice and then add it to your spag bol, chilli etc...
